Baku: Azerbaijani Minister of Foreign Affairs Jeyhun Bayramov and Jordan's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s and Expatriate Ayman Safadi held a telephone conversation on March 2 to discuss the escalating tensions in the Middle East. The conversation revolved around the military-political situation currently unfolding in the region.
According to Azerbaijan State News Agency, both ministers emphasized the importance of halting further deterioration of the regional security environment. They highlighted the necessity of addressing existing discrepancies through dialogue and diplomatic means, in line with international law norms and principles.
The ministers also prioritized the security of civilians and the prevention of a worsening humanitarian situation. They stressed the need for increased global efforts to maintain stability and security in the region, while also touching upon other issues of mutual concern.
